Plinko, at its core, is a game of vertical chance. It’s visually characterized by a board filled with pegs, and the gameplay involves dropping a puck (or ball) from the top. As the puck descends, it bounces randomly off the pegs, altering its path until it eventually settles in one of the prize slots at the bottom. The higher the value of the slot, the greater the payout. It’s remarkably easy to understand and play, making it accessible to both seasoned casino players and newcomers alike.

The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)
In the realm of online casinos, fairness and transparency are paramount. To ensure a genuinely random outcome in games like plinko, developers heavily rely on Random Number Generators, or RNGs. These sophisticated algorithms produce sequences of numbers that are impossible to predict, guaranteeing that each puck drop is independent of previous results. Reputable online casinos regularly submit their RNGs to independent auditing to verify their fairness and authenticity.
The integrity of the RNG is crucial for maintaining player trust. A biased or compromised RNG could be manipulated to favor the house or specific players, destroying the game’s integrity. Therefore, regulatory bodies impose strict testing requirements on casino operators to ensure these systems function correctly. Looking for certifications from respected testing agencies, like eCOGRA, is a wise step for players seeking a secure and fair gaming experience.
